.reset_mainForm__lv1_m{display:flex;flex-direction:column;align-items:center;gap:1rem}.reset_pageWrapper__rLTXb{display:flex;justify-content:center;align-items:center;min-height:100vh;background-color:var(--background-color);padding:1rem}.reset_formCard__K2v9u{background:#fff;width:100%;max-width:400px;padding:2rem;border-radius:8px;box-shadow:0 0 10px rgba(0,0,0,.1);text-align:center;color:#666}.reset_title__uspp5{font-size:1.5rem;margin-bottom:1rem}.reset_description__pSDrM{font-size:.95rem;color:#666;margin-bottom:1.5rem}.reset_formGroup__CoHvL{text-align:left;margin-bottom:1.5rem}.reset_formGroup__CoHvL label{display:block;font-weight:400;margin-bottom:.5rem;margin-left:.5rem}.reset_headerForm__XsToB{position:relative}.reset_messageError__I9qwK{color:red;margin-bottom:1rem}.reset_messageSuccess__aTkt0{color:green;margin-bottom:1rem}.password-input_toggleButton__mmbJY{position:relative;float:right;background:none;border:none;cursor:pointer;font-size:18px;color:#ccc;top:-30px;margin-right:5px}.password-input_labelForm__6ttmX{display:block;font-weight:500;margin-bottom:.5rem;color:#000}.force-password-change_mainForm__pMHCP{display:flex;flex-direction:column;align-items:center;gap:1rem}.force-password-change_headerForm__ojTWI{position:relative}.force-password-change_pageWrapper__9vsN7{display:flex;justify-content:center;align-items:center;min-height:100vh;background-color:var(--background-color);padding:1rem}.force-password-change_formCard__WEuqb{background:#fff;width:100%;max-width:400px;padding:2rem;border-radius:8px;box-shadow:0 0 10px rgba(0,0,0,.1);text-align:center;color:#666}.force-password-change_labelForm__yDKXD{display:block;font-weight:500;margin-bottom:.5rem;color:#000}.force-password-change_logo__Jyl1b{max-width:150px;margin:0 auto 1rem;display:block}.force-password-change_description__JlVro{font-size:.95rem;margin-bottom:1.5rem}.force-password-change_formGroup__tLm7Q{text-align:left;margin-bottom:1.5rem}.force-password-change_formGroup__tLm7Q label{display:block;font-weight:400;margin-bottom:.5rem;margin-left:.5rem}.force-password-change_forgotPasswordWrapper__8_99c{margin-top:8px;text-align:right;margin-right:25px}.force-password-change_forgotPasswordLink__CXG9v{font-size:14px;color:#007bff;text-decoration:none}.force-password-change_forgotPasswordLink__CXG9v:hover{text-decoration:underline}.force-password-change_messageError__qS_ap{color:red;margin-bottom:1rem}.force-password-change_termsCheckbox__IeBjO{align-items:flex-start;text-align:left;width:100%;margin-bottom:15px}.force-password-change_termsCheckbox__IeBjO .MuiCheckbox-root.Mui-checked{color:var(--primary-color)!important}